The Quality of Private ADHD Assessments Has Come Under Questioning

A BBC Panorama investigation has recently brought the quality of private adhd assessment Maidstone clinic ADHD assessment under scrutiny. This revealed how an undercover reporter was diagnosed with ADHD at three private clinics however, he had a more detailed face-to-face NHS assessment, which concluded that it was not the condition.

Many patients are forced, however to seek out private diagnosis and treatment because of the long NHS waiting lists. What is the procedure for private assessments, though?

What is an assessment that is private?

A private ADHD assessment is a thorough process that begins with a clinical interview, which can be conducted in person, over the phone or via video link. The psychologist or psychiatrist who is conducting the assessment will also take an extensive medical history and may use additional tests like neuropsychological tests to provide insights into your strengths, weaknesses, and any other comorbidities you have.

During the examination the doctor will discuss the impact that the symptoms you are experiencing have on your life and work on finding the most effective type of treatment for you. It could be CBT or medication, but it's crucial to determine which is the most effective for you.

After you receive a diagnosis after receiving a diagnosis, you can visit your GP to sign what is referred to as an "shared care agreement". The psychologist or psychiatrist who diagnosed you will write to your GP with a form to sign that states that you will be returning to their care. You will then be able to go back to your GP for follow-up appointments and ongoing treatment.

What to Expect Following an Assessment in Private

A private assessment starts with a medical interview that focuses on symptoms and medical histories. During this process it is crucial that the person being assessed be open and honest and not reserving information because of feelings of shame or fear of being judged. The accuracy of information will determine the quality of evaluation and treatment recommendations.

It is also common for the psychiatrist to request the patient to fill out a questionnaire. This is intended to help the doctor identify and assess the severity of adult ADHD which include impulsivity as well as inattention. The psychiatrist will also ask about the impact that the symptoms have had on the person's life, and may discuss the person's personal relationships as well.

In a lot of Private ADHD assessment Bristol cost examinations, a family member or a close friend may be included as a collateral source. This is because the psychiatrist wants to know whether the person's symptoms affect them at home or in stressful work situations. It is difficult to determine the impact of these symptoms when a person is alone with a psychiatrist. This is why someone who is intimately familiar with them is a good source of feedback.

Some specialists may employ additional instruments during an assessment, such as cognitive tests, or a neuropsychological test. These tests provide a more comprehensive picture of the person's strengths and weaknesses and allow the doctor to determine any comorbid conditions that could be contributing to their symptoms.

Report writing is typically the final phase of an evaluation. The report will include a diagnosis and, should it be necessary an action plan for treatment.
